Active Real Estate Investing Strategies

Buy and Hold

The buy and hold strategy requires buying a building or land and retaining it for a significant period. While it is being kept, it is usually rented or leased, to increase returns.

At any time down the road, the investment asset can be sold if capital is needed for other investments, or if the real estate market is particularly active.

Price to rent ratio

The price to rent ratio (p/r) is the median property price divided by the annual median gross rent. A market with high lease prices will have a lower p/r. This will permit your rental to pay itself off within a sensible period of time. Look out for an exceptionally low p/r, which might make it more costly to rent a property than to acquire one. This may push renters into buying a home and inflate rental unit unoccupied ratios. However, lower p/r ratios are generally more acceptable than high ratios.

Long Term Rental (BRRRR)

The term BRRRR is an illustration of a long-term lease strategy — Buy, Rehab, Rent, Refinance, Repeat. BRRRR is a system for consistent growth. This plan hinges on your capability to extract cash out when you refinance.

The After Repair Value (ARV) of the investment property needs to total more than the total purchase and repair expenses. Then you obtain a cash-out mortgage refinance loan that is calculated on the superior property worth, and you pocket the balance. You employ that money to acquire an additional asset and the operation starts again. You acquire additional houses or condos and repeatedly increase your rental revenues.

Short Term Rentals

Residential properties where renters stay in furnished accommodations for less than four weeks are referred to as short-term rentals. Short-term rentals charge a steeper price each night than in long-term rental properties. With renters moving from one place to the next, short-term rentals have to be maintained and sanitized on a consistent basis.

Typical short-term tenants are excursionists, home sellers who are buying another house, and people traveling for business who want a more homey place than a hotel room. House sharing portals like AirBnB and VRBO have encouraged a lot of residential property owners to engage in the short-term rental industry. This makes short-term rental strategy an easy approach to try residential property investing.

Short-term rental landlords require dealing one-on-one with the renters to a greater degree than the owners of yearly rented properties. Short-Term Rental Cash-on-Cash Return

To know if you should put your money in a particular investment asset or community, look at the cash-on-cash return. Divide the Net Operating Income (NOI) by the amount of cash used. The return is a percentage. High cash-on-cash return shows that you will regain your cash quicker and the purchase will be more profitable. If you take a loan for part of the investment and spend less of your funds, you will get a higher cash-on-cash return.

Average Short-Term Rental Capitalization (Cap) Rates

Average short-term rental capitalization (cap) rates are largely utilized by real property investors to evaluate the value of investment opportunities. High cap rates show that properties are accessible in that region for decent prices. If cap rates are low, you can assume to pay more for real estate in that city. Divide your projected Net Operating Income (NOI) by the investment property’s value or purchase price. This shows you a ratio that is the per-annum return, or cap rate.

Fix and Flip

To fix and flip a property, you need to get it for less than market price, complete any required repairs and updates, then dispose of the asset for full market value. The secrets to a successful fix and flip are to pay a lower price for the investment property than its present value and to carefully calculate the amount needed to make it marketable.

It is crucial for you to be aware of what properties are going for in the area. Select an area with a low average Days On Market (DOM) metric. Disposing of the home quickly will keep your expenses low and guarantee your profitability.

Wholesaling

Wholesaling is a real estate investment approach that requires finding houses that are appealing to investors and putting them under a purchase contract. When an investor who needs the residential property is spotted, the purchase contract is assigned to the buyer for a fee. The real buyer then completes the transaction. The wholesaler doesn’t sell the residential property — they sell the rights to purchase one.

Mortgage Note Investing

Note investing means buying debt (mortgage note) from a lender for less than the balance owed. When this happens, the investor becomes the borrower’s lender.

When a mortgage loan is being repaid on time, it is thought of as a performing note. They give you monthly passive income. Non-performing mortgage notes can be re-negotiated or you may buy the property for less than face value via foreclosure.

Foreclosure Laws

It’s imperative for mortgage note investors to know the foreclosure laws in their state. Are you working with a Deed of Trust or a mortgage? A mortgage dictates that you go to court for permission to start foreclosure. A Deed of Trust enables you to file a public notice and start foreclosure.

Property Taxes

Usually, lenders accept the property taxes from the customer every month. The mortgage lender passes on the property taxes to the Government to ensure they are submitted on time. The lender will have to make up the difference if the payments halt or the investor risks tax liens on the property. If taxes are past due, the government’s lien leapfrogs any other liens to the head of the line and is paid first.

Because tax escrows are included with the mortgage loan payment, increasing property taxes indicate larger mortgage loan payments. Homeowners who are having a hard time making their mortgage payments might fall farther behind and ultimately default.

Passive Real Estate Investing Strategies

Syndications

In real estate investing, a syndication is a group of investors who gather their capital and abilities to buy real estate properties for investment. One person puts the deal together and recruits the others to invest.

The person who pulls everything together is the Sponsor, often known as the Syndicator. The syndicator is responsible for performing the purchase or development and developing revenue. The Sponsor oversees all partnership matters including the distribution of profits.

Syndication members are passive investors. The partnership agrees to pay them a preferred return when the business is turning a profit. These owners have nothing to do with managing the syndication or handling the use of the property.

Ownership Interest

The Syndication is fully owned by all the owners. You ought to search for syndications where the members investing capital receive a larger percentage of ownership than partners who are not investing.

As a cash investor, you should also intend to be given a preferred return on your investment before profits are disbursed. When profits are achieved, actual investors are the first who collect a negotiated percentage of their investment amount. After the preferred return is paid, the rest of the profits are disbursed to all the participants.

If the property is finally sold, the members receive a negotiated share of any sale profits. Adding this to the ongoing income from an investment property notably enhances an investor’s returns. The company’s operating agreement explains the ownership framework and how everyone is dealt with financially.

REITs

Some real estate investment firms are conceived as trusts called Real Estate Investment Trusts or REITs. This was originally conceived as a method to enable the ordinary person to invest in real property. Many investors currently are able to invest in a REIT.

REIT investing is one of the types of passive investing. The liability that the investors are accepting is diversified within a group of investment real properties. Investors are able to sell their REIT shares anytime they need. Something you can’t do with REIT shares is to select the investment real estate properties. You are restricted to the REIT’s portfolio of real estate properties for investment.

Real Estate Investment Funds

Mutual funds that contain shares of real estate companies are called real estate investment funds. The fund doesn’t own real estate — it holds interest in real estate firms. Investment funds are considered a cost-effective method to incorporate real estate in your appropriation of assets without needless liability. Where REITs are required to disburse dividends to its members, funds do not. The return to you is generated by growth in the worth of the stock.

You can pick a fund that concentrates on a predetermined type of real estate you’re aware of, but you do not get to select the market of each real estate investment. As passive investors, fund participants are glad to permit the administration of the fund make all investment determinations.
